Join Greg Lamont and Liz Jeavons-Fellows who share their passion and broad knowledge of horticulture to excite you about gardening.

Living in small spaces is not a barrier to creating a beautiful lush and sustainable garden.

Topics covered include:

  • Planting aspect (sun/shade, dry/wet, sheltered/exposed)

  • Understanding soils and potting mixes

  • Growing in containers

  • Watering and plant nutrition

  • Design and plant selection, including proven winners

  • Vegetables and herbs

  • Green walls
